Zdzisław Beksiński was born in Sanok, southern Poland. ![]() The second period contained more abstract style, with the main features of formalism.īeksiński was stabbed to death at his Warsaw apartment on February 21, 2005, by a 19-year-old acquaintance from Wołomin, reportedly because he refused to lend him money. The first period of work is generally considered to contain expressionistic color, with a strong style of "utopian realism" and surreal architecture, like a doomsday scenario. His creations were made mainly in two periods.
